Nalbandian: Baku struck a blow at the OSCE mission in the region,  refusing to join the consensus on the extension of the mandate of the  Yerevan office

ArmInfo. The flouting of common norms and principles is not spontaneous, nor is it surprising that the OSCE member state, which defied the Yerevan office of the  Organization, was left alone and was isolated. Armenian FM Edward  Nalbandian stated this in Vienna on July 11 during a speech at the  informal meeting of the foreign ministers of the OSCE member states.

The statement particularly reads as follows:  "Joining efforts with a  view to overcoming distrust and increasing confidence is enshrined in  the birth certificate of this Organization, while dialogue and  cooperation have been long identified as the instruments for  achieving our common goals. We appreciate the Chairmanship's  initiative to once again apply to the foundations of the OSCE, since  neither dialogue, nor cooperation can be taken as granted nowadays.   We hope that this kind of discussions can contribute to reviving the  true spirit of cooperation, being mindful that the most noticeable  accomplishments of the OSCE have been secured through dialogue and  compromise, political will and good faith.

The setbacks of our cooperation and erosion of trust do not merely  limit to the existing disagreements on number of areas. Here we refer  also to the abuse of the principle of consensus, the consequences of  which go far beyond from damaging the trust, especially in the cases  where there is none, but rather shaking the very essence of the OSCE  which is designed to solve the issues through dialogue and  cooperation and never through imposing the position of one  participating State at the expense of all others and the entire  Organization.  Thus, the refusal of Azerbaijan to join the consensus  on the extension of the mandate of the OSCE Office in Yerevan damages  not merely the integrity of the field missions of the OSCE but its  capacity of inclusive cooperation in implementing the commitments.  Azerbaijan failed to respect the OSCE commitments back home and  eliminated the OSCE Office in its own country before it attacked and  closed the OSCE last assets in the region.

The violation and abuse of shared norms and principles do not happen  in a vacuum. It does not come as a surprise that this participating  State found itself alone and in isolation in challenging the OSCE  Office in Yerevan.  The dire record of Azerbaijan's noncompliance  encompasses all three dimensions of the OSCE. The leadership of  Azerbaijan uses every opportunity to boast about multiculturalism  allegedly cultivated by them. In reality thousands masterpieces of  Armenian cultural and historic heritage, sacred sites, churches,  monasteries, cross stones destroyed and erased by Azerbaijan testify  to the contrary. The 2016 report of the European Commission Against  Racism and Intolerance states: "Political leaders, educational  institutions and media have continued using hate speech against  Armenians; an entire generation of Azerbaijanis has now grown up  listening to this hateful rhetoric". It is this generation raised in  the environment of such propaganda that again and again commits  despicable crimes. How could the leadership of Baku talk about  multiculturalism at the same time declaring that "all Armenians of  the world are number one enemies of Azerbaijan"?  Probably it  considers this to be part of Baku's self-proclaimed "intelligent  power". There is nothing smart in trying to mislead the international  community, especially those countries that do not have, difficulty to  find out the truth, to warn their citizens of the Armenian origin to  avoid visiting Azerbaijan, where they will be subjected to outrageous  racist discriminating practice on the basis of their ethnicity.

In April 2016 Azerbaijan unleashed a large scale aggression against  Nagorno-Karabakh that was accompanied by the grave violations of  international humanitarian law, atrocities against the civilian  population, including children, women and elderly persons, mutilation  of the bodies, Daesh-style beheadings, which have been condemned by  international community.  The OSCE Minsk Group Co-Chair countries  initiated Summits in Vienna and St. Petersburg aimed at overcoming  the consequences of Azerbaijan's aggression as well as at creating  conducive conditions for the advancement of the negotiation process.   During the Vienna Summit it was particularly agreed upon and then  reconfirmed in St. Petersburg to establish the OSCE mechanism for  investigation of the ceasefire violations; to increase the number and  enhance the capacity of the OSCE monitors on the line of contact  between Nagorno-Karabakh and Azerbaijan, and on the border between  Armenia and Azerbaijan. The commitment on the exclusively peaceful  settlement of the conflict was reiterated, the strict adherence to  the 1994-1995 ceasefire agreements was emphasised.  Trust and  confidence are built when agreements are implemented. With this  understanding Armenia and Nagorno-Karabakh gave their consents to  implement the mentioned high level agreements. Azerbaijan backtracked  from those agreements as it had done with prior commitments many  times before. This attitude of Azerbaijan questions its credibility  for being a party to negotiations, which honours its agreements.

In the framework of the OSCE trust means first of all trust into  Organization and its ability to address eminent security challenges  in Europe.  We firmly believe that based on the proposals of the  Co-Chairs the OSCE should enhance its presence on the ground in the  conflict zone on more permanent and stronger basis. In this respect  the OSCE could help all parties to the conflict to respect ceasefire,  avoid military escalation and build trust and confidence. The OSCE is  an organization which was created on the lessons of history and  history teaches us on many occasions that war is an outcome of  misperception and miscalculation of security environment while peace  is an outcome of trust.  Azerbaijan has chosen a different path.

People on all sides of the conflict deserve to know who pushes them  to the path of loss and suffering. Identifying the security threats  in impartial and responsible manner is important for credibility of  this Organization as well.  We took note that in their statement the  OSCE Minsk Group Co-Chairs identified Azerbaijan as a party who first  resorted to the violence.  This has been far not the first appeal of  the Co-Chairs addressed directly to Azerbaijan. On previous occasions  the Co-Chairs have made a number of clear cut statements calling Baku  to refrain from the escalation of the situation, to reaffirm the  commitment to peaceful settlement of the issue, to refrain from  criticizing the OSCE Minsk Group Co-Chair countries and to respect  their mandate, give up efforts to shift the conflict resolution to  other formats, to agree to the establishment of investigation  mechanism of ceasefire violations. In response to Azerbaijan's claims  that tried to question the validity of the ceasefire agreements of  1994 and 1995, the Co-Chairs clearly stated that these agreements  have no time limitation and should be strictly adhered to.

However, Azerbaijan ignores all appeals of the Co-Chair countries and  continues to stick to its highly destructive attitude at the  negotiation table and provocative actions in the conflict zone.  On  July 4th the Azerbaijani leadership once again resorted to the  tactics of notorious terrorist organizations and as many times before  used its civilian population as a human shield for shelling the  territory of Nagorno-Karabakh by heavy weaponry, including by  multiple rocket launcher systems. In response, the Defense Army of  Nagorno-Karabakh was obliged to exercise self-defense against the  aggressive actions of the Azerbaijani side. Baku clearly demonstrated  that it is not capable to comprehend the appeals of the Co Chairs.   As long as Azerbaijan fails to respect its international commitments  in compliance with 1994-1995 trilateral ceasefire agreements, refuses  to implement the Vienna and St. Petersburg Summit commitments,  especially on the creation of the mechanism for investigation of the  ceasefire violations, that can become also a mechanism for prevention  of escalation, Baku bears full responsibility for all consequences  for such behaviour.

This stresses once again the imperative for the international  community to consider more tangible means to curb Azerbaijan.  We are  bound together to advance the cause of peace and security through the  OSCE. We will continue to be actively involved in all efforts aimed  at building cooperation, consent and trust in the OSCE area.
